Understanding the A1 Certificate

The A1 certificate, officially called the "Statement regarding the social security legislation which applies to the holder," validates which nation's social security system a mobile worker belongs to. Its primary purpose is to ensure that social security contributions are not paid in two nations simultaneously and to show that an employee is covered by their home country's insurance coverage while working abroad briefly.

Who Needs an A1 Certificate?

  1. Published Workers: Employees sent by their employer to work in another Member State for a duration of as much as 24 months.
  2. Multi-State Workers: Individuals who normally work in 2 or more Member States (e.g., global truck chauffeurs or consultants).
  3. Self-Employed Individuals: Entrepreneurs carrying out services in different EU jurisdictions.
  4. Civil Servants: Working in various Member States for their federal government.

Common Hurdles in the A1 Lifecycle

Despite whether one uses directly or spends for a service, specific obstructions are frequently pointed out in user experiences:

  1. The "24-Month Rule": If a publishing surpasses 24 months, the A1 is usually no longer applicable, and the worker must shift to the host nation's social security system. Browsing this shift is a common point of confusion.
  2. Wait Times: Despite digitalization, some nationwide authorities (such as those in Germany or France) can experience stockpiles, causing hold-ups that can endanger work start dates.
  3. Retroactive Applications: While it is possible to make an application for an A1 retroactively, numerous employees experience stress when requested for the document on-site by foreign labor inspectors before the application has actually been processed.

1. Is the A1 certificate mandatory for short business trips?

Legally, yes. The majority of EU policies need an A1 for any expert activity abroad, though some countries have high thresholds for enforcement on very short journeys (1-- 2 days). However, for building, transport, or manual work, it is strictly imposed from day one.

2. Can I purchase an A1 certificate from a private company?

You can not "purchase" the certificate itself, as it must be issued by a government body. You are paying the company to function as your representative, handle the documents, and utilize their proficiency to ensure an effective application.

3. How long is the A1 certificate legitimate?

The certificate is legitimate throughout of the posting defined in the application, up to an optimum of 24 months. For multi-state employees, it is often issued for 12 months and must be restored each year.

4. What occurs if I work abroad without an A1?

The company and the staff member might go through fines. More notably, the host country might require that social security contributions be paid into their system, leading to double taxation until the circumstance is remedied.
